§ 4-20-114 — Duties of registered agent

The only duties under this chapter of a registered agent who has complied with this chapter are:

(1)to forward to the represented entity at the address most recently supplied to the agent by the entity any process, notice, or demand that is served on the agent;
(2)to provide the notices required by this chapter to the entity at the address most recently supplied to the agent by the entity;
(3)if the agent is a noncommercial registered agent, to keep current the information required by § 4-20-105(a) in the most recent registered agent filing for the entity; and (4) if the agent is a commercial registered agent, to keep current the information listed for it under § 4-20-106(a) .

Legislative History

Acts 2007, No. 638, § 1.
